The "McGonigal" case has become the subject of recent discussions and debates in politics and the Albanian public. In the show "Open" on News24, the editor-in-chief of BIRN, Besart Likmeta, spoke about the testimony of McGonigal's ex-girlfriend, from which the FBI's investigation of the former agent is said to have started, as well as about the information published so far about this matter.

Likmeta said that we don't know if it was this indication that prompted the FBI to open an investigation against their former agent and spoke about other circumstances.

He further pointed out that Business Insider published an article a few months ago that showed a kind of request from the grand jury, or court, to provide documents and information that were connected between the Prime Minister of Albania, McGonigal and two people who are suspected to be Person A and Person B, Agron Nezaj and Dorian Ducka.

Likmeta: These are details reported by an American publication that interviewed Mrs. Guerriero, we as the Albanian media do not have to verify how true they are.

She may have sent this email out of jealousy, or a desire to get revenge on her partner, but we don't know if this was the clue that prompted the FBI to open an investigation into their former agent.

There are other circumstances regarding Agent McGonigal's contacts with Russian oligarch Deripaska, or persons connected to Deripaska. There was a statement to the Justice department from one of these people in terms of the contacts he had with McGonigal and some of the lobbying that was done. There was also a New York Times article that talked about how McGonigal secured an internship for the daughter of a former Russian diplomat with the NYPD and raised suspicions because she testified or told him. some of the officers there had access to FBI files. One of the police officers reported such a fact, finding it suspicious how such a young and foreign girl could have access to FBI documents.

She (Guerriero) had some kind of basic information that McGonigal was dealing with Albanian citizens, that he was traveling to Albania, and this is not entirely clear from the Business Insider article because Business Insider in this case is not that interested in the Albanian part, but it will show the origin where this type of denunciation may have come from.

Business Insider, the same journalist has published an article a few months ago that showed a kind of request from the grand jury, or court to provide documents and information that were connected between the Prime Minister of Albania, McGonigal and two people who are suspected to be Person A and Person B , Agron Nezaj and Dorian Ducka.

With the rule of thirds, we can assume that the person who may have given him this document was the ex-FBI agent's girlfriend.

Klodiana Lala: Undeclared trips, meetings with Albanian officials, lunches and dinners in different areas of the north, business also in Albania. All these make this story interesting. It is an ongoing investigation, more details may come to light. What we should be interested in is how a former FBI agent brought the entire Albanian government together, had lunch with ministers, with mayors, received the title of honorary citizen, became a shareholder of a studio.

Likmeta: The BIRN article was about lobbying for the money that DP paid to secure a photo with Trump, where a part is stated to have come from an offshore company.

We didn't report that it was Russian money because we couldn't prove it, but it was a climate in the US at the time where the media had an interest in linking everything to Russian influence. One thing has been overlooked, the most important thing that our prosecutor's office should investigate, is that he came to lobby the Albanian prime minister on behalf of an oil company. There is a suspicion that an accused corrupt FBI agent has come to our country to influence the Prime Minister.
